Naoto Fukosawa & Jasper Morrison - SUPER NORMAL
In 2004, Jesper Morrison and Naoto Fukasawa collected everyday objects in search of extraordinary design. Alongside examples of anonymous designs, the collection includes design classics by designers such as Arne Jacobsen, Dieter Rams, Max Bill, and Noguchi. With products by Newson, Grcic, the Azumis, and the Bouroullecs, the collection also represents the generation to which Morrison and Fukasawa belong.
The phenomenon of the extraordinary exists beyond space and time and points to a future that began long ago. It lies openly before us, it is real and tangible: Fukasawa and Morrison make it visible for us.
